What’s So Special About the Buck Moon?
The Buck Moon gets its name from the time of year when male deer grow their antlers. But it’s not just a pretty name; this full moon has cultural significance across multiple traditions. Many indigenous tribes celebrated this moon for its association with summer and abundance.
When to Look Up
Get ready! The Buck Moon will reach its peak on July 3rd. However, you don’t need to wait until then to catch a glimpse; it will appear full from July 2nd to July 5th. Find a quiet spot away from city lights and prepare to be amazed!
Best Viewing Tips
Want to enhance your experience? Grab a blanket, some snacks, and maybe a friend or two. The more, the merrier! Bring binoculars or a telescope for a closer look at the moon’s craters and valleys.
